I have an A1200/Ming but it doesn't seem to work with Zimbra.

It looks to be VERY close to working though if a developer can spend some quality time with it.

My log file looks like this:

2007-09-20 17:06:14,472 INFO [http-80-Processor99] [] sync - OPTIONS Microsoft-Server-ActiveSync?DeviceId=MOTOEZX0e08faf18bd52b5f87af676 54&DeviceType=MotEzx
2007-09-20 17:06:14,543 INFO [http-80-Processor99] [] sync - HTTP/1.1 401 Unauthorized
2007-09-20 17:06:16,236 INFO [http-80-Processor98] [] sync - OPTIONS Microsoft-Server-ActiveSync?User=mark&DeviceId=MOTOEZX0e08faf18bd52 b5f87af67654&DeviceType=MotEzx
2007-09-20 17:06:16,250 INFO [http-80-Processor98] [] sync - User not found; user=mydomain.net/mark
2007-09-20 17:06:16,250 INFO [http-80-Processor98] [] sync - HTTP/1.1 401 Invalid username or password
